Clicking on the … green tree lending payday loanThe oldest translation of the Bible into a Slavic language, Old Church Slavonic, has close connections with the activity of the two apostles to the Slavs, Cyril and Methodius, in Great Moravia in 864–865. It was implemented at the Preslav Literary School, although it was attributed to Cyril and Methodius. The oldest manuscripts use either the so-called Cyrillic or the Glagolitic alphabets. Cyril’s and Methodius’s spiritual son Saint Procopius, and after the Union of Brest, they sought to destroy it in Ruthenia; but Saints Job and Peter (Mohyla) put a stop to it. fnf destination playerThe first translation of the whole Bible into Czech, based on the Latin Vulgate, was done around 1360. The first printed Bible was published in 1488 (the Prague Bible).
